800 Degrees Neapolitan Pizzeria is a Los Angeles-based build-your-own pizza chain which was awarded the title of “true Neapolitan pizza” by the Associazione Verace Pizza Napoletana in 2012. It took Dubai by storm when it opened its first franchise at Me’aisem City Center a couple of years ago. My wife and daughter are HUGE fans. This MOE branch rubs one shoulder with another culinary sensation, Din Tai Fung, and the other with VOX Cinema. Talk about prime location.
The 800° menu is (obviously) primarily about pizzas but there are also burratas (must try), soups and salads to choose from. I don’t know how they do it, but their pizzas are in a different league to other pizzerias. Central to the 800° concept is to build your own pizza, and there are literally unlimited possibilities. Outside my own kitchen, I like things decided for me and invariably choose à la carte.
Service is friendly and accommodating. Boutique pizzerias like the newly opened (and totally insane) Akiba Dori, and Italian restaurant-based pizzerias like (also newly opened) Luigia in JBR aside, 800° Neapolitan Pizzeria is best of the franchises…and well worth a visit.
